“Sad, sad, sad!”
1 of 5 stars Reviewed 18 December 2011 via mobile
2
people found this review helpful

We were greeted with "you are a day late". We weren't but that didn't seem to matter to this owner. We proved that we hadn't made a mistake but there was no apology. The front door was Mortice-locked, which we had to on entering and leaving each time, which did not seem very welcoming, even though the handle on the outside was falling off. Was this an attempt to make guests responsible for hotel security? There were four dog bones, a dog toy and a yapping/barking dog in the hall - there is no reception desk. Also the dog is allowed to lie on the seats in the residents' lounge covering the common areas and seats with dog hairs! Our room had the dirtiest carpet we have ever had in an hotel, corners didn't get cleaned and the bedside lamp was covered in cobwebs and dust. To say it was an hotel was wrong - a B&B would have been nearer the mark and then we wouldn't have chosen it. It is something out of the 1970s with low maintenance, damp patch on the ceiling and very worn paint. Although the owner tried to be friendly and helpful, he just didn't manage it - the whole place is sad, sad, sad.
In it's favour is the breakfast. The food is good, the choice is good and the service is quick.
However, breakfast alone cannot offset all the negatives. An experience we do not wish to repeat.

“Stay here at your pearl”
1 of 5 stars Reviewed 3 October 2011
2
people found this review helpful

WARNING - Do not stay here if you value your health and well being. Apon arrival we were greeted by an overwelming smell of rotten dogs and stale smoke. There was a dog waiting to greet us which was freindly but stinking. The room had black damp in the seiling, there was a rotten smell of excrement coming from the toilet as they have shredder toilets, something i have not come across nor want to ever again. The bed had a huge dip in it making it very uncomfortable. Apon waking up we headed down stairs to recieve our breakfast only to be served it with added dog hair in it. This was the final straw. i packed our bags and proceeded to check out as fast as we could, On check out the owner did not seem 1 bit surpirised that we were checking out 2 days early and did not even ask why, they surely must experience this quite alot. After leaving i passed by sometime later only to hear another guest outside on the phone saying how disgusted she was with the place. This is by far the worst hotel i have stayed in within the UK and frankly should be shut down immediately.

“A shame basic standards let it down”
3 of 5 stars Reviewed 17 August 2011
3
people found this review helpful

Seven members of our family (4 adults, 3 children aged 12, 6 and 2) visited The Sefton for a 2 night break, staying in two family rooms. Our party all agreed that with a little TLC, some serious deep cleaning and maybe some investment in the decor this would be a fab little hotel. Even the front of house could do with a bit of attention as the garden furniture looked rotted and 'kerb appeal' was sadly lacking. I've just put our observations here but all in all we had a good stay but did not enjoy the lingering aroma which even came home with us as it was on our clothes as we unpacked.
Good points: the hosts were very friendly, helpful and knowledgeable about amenities in the area. The breakfast was very nice with plently of toast, tea & coffee. The hotel states it has a bar, which it did, but did not seem to have any stock for it. When we asked for wine, the lady said she would go out and buy some; we just supplied our own which they were fine with. The hotel is a fair bit away from the main attractions but there is a tram stop at the top of the road and it only cost £10.50 for all seven of us to the Pleasure Beach/Sandcastle.
Bad points: as you enter the hotel for the first time upon your arrival you are greeted with a strange smell, a mix of nicotine,dust and dog. This is noticeable throughout the hotel. One of the family rooms looked out onto the yard at the back of the property and each morning I had to close the window as the cigarette smoke from below permeated our room above.
The en-suite facilities were adequate, the shower looked quite new and therefore operated really well plus we had nice white fluffy towels. Family members in the other room had almost threadbare towels and flannels with stains on.
The bedding was clean but the bed had seen better days, creaked every time you moved on it. During the night you would radiate to the dip in the middle, so we didn't get a good night's sleep. On the whole our room could have done with a clean, there was a film of dust over most things and the carpet looked very dirty with many stains, especially leading from the bed toward the toilet (?!?!)
DON'T bother visiting The Gynn Pub on the roundabout as it is a dump. Families are herded into a gated area, none of the kiddies attractions were working, all over the place were signs saying 'Out of Order'. Also the language from some of the staff as they conversed with 'regulars' was quite foul. Uncle Tom's Cabin (around the corner from the hotel) is another to avoid as this was full of men smoking (no regard for legislation here), not very comfortable; definately NOT the place to take young children.

I hope the owners take the criticisims constructively as this could be a really nice place to stay if the standards of cleanliness and guest comfort was prioritised.
